Solar Energy in Jeffersonville, Indiana

Jeffersonville, Indiana receives an average of 4.6 peak sun hours per day, providing excellent conditions for residential solar installations. With electricity rates averaging 13.0¢ per kWh from Indiana Michigan Power, below the national average, but with rates rising 2-3% annually, the long-term savings are still meaningful.

A typical 6kW solar system in Jeffersonville produces approximately 8,059 kWh per year, saving homeowners an estimated $1,048 annually. The system pays for itself in about 13.2 years, after which you enjoy essentially free electricity for the remaining 12+ years of the system's warranty life.

Jeffersonville has a solar penetration rate of 2% — indicating early-stage solar adoption with tremendous growth potential as prices continue to fall. The cost of living index of 88.4 (national average: 100) reflects a lower cost of living, keeping installation costs competitive.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much do solar panels cost in Jeffersonville, IN?

The average cost of a 6kW solar panel system in Jeffersonville is approximately $19,800 before incentives ($3.30/watt). After the 30% federal Investment Tax Credit, the net cost is about $13,860. Federal 30% ITC; check local utility for additional rebates.

How many peak sun hours does Jeffersonville get?

Jeffersonville, IN receives an average of 4.6 peak sun hours per day and approximately 191 sunny days per year. This is near the national average, providing good conditions for residential solar panels.

What is the solar payback period in Jeffersonville?

The average solar payback period in Jeffersonville is approximately 13.6 years. After payback, your solar panels generate essentially free electricity for the remaining 15-20 years of their warranty. Over 25 years, total savings can reach $35,797.

Does Jeffersonville have net metering?

Yes, Jeffersonville has access to net metering through Indiana Michigan Power. This allows you to earn credits for excess solar energy sent to the grid, significantly improving your solar investment returns.

Is solar worth it in Jeffersonville, IN?

Yes, solar is a solid investment in Jeffersonville. While the 13.6-year payback is moderate, you'll still save $35,797 over 25 years. The 30% federal tax credit and local incentives help make solar financially attractive.
